Hopefully this guide helps you when you see the bug propagation wiki.
Stop wasting time with computer errors.
Error propagation can be a type of dithering in which the rest of the quantization is distributed for you to neighboring pixels that have not yet been processed. Its main use, no doubt, is to continuously convert a layered image to binary, although it seems to have other uses as well.
Unlike many other forms of filtering, a broadcast error is classified as a single-zone operation because what the algorithm’s formula does in one place affects what happens elsewhere. This common remedy is necessary and makes comparable treatment difficult. One-off surgeries like Got Dither do not cause complications for these people.
Error propagation improves the edges of the image. This definitely makes text images more readable than other grayscale methods.
Richard Howland Ranger received US patent 1,790,723 for the invention of a “facsimile system”. A patent, issued around 1931, describes a system for transferring files by telephone, telephoneFreeware or just radio links.  Ranger’s invention continually provides audio recordings that are first converted to black and white and then moved to remote locations, where virtually every pen moves across a sheet of paper attached to it. To depict black, the drawing was dropped onto paper; In order to really highlight the white color, a pen was applied. Shades of gray were rendered by temporarily raising and lowering the canine, depending on how bright you want the gray. invention
Capacitors the Ranger uses to store charges, and vacuum TV comparators to determine when the generated brightness and accumulated errors are above a threshold (which causes the stylus to rise) or below (which results in some type) the pen was mentioned has been omitted). In this important sense, it was an analog transcription of error propagation.
The Digital Age
Floyd and Steinberg described a digital imaging system based on a simple kernel in the name of error propagation:
where “” means the pixel in the current short film that it was already normally included (so there would seem to be no need to propagate bugs), and the “#” denotes the exact pixel that is being processed.
Almost simultaneously, J.F. Jarvis, C.N. Judis, and W.H. Ninke of Bell Labs proposed a similar method, which they called “minimized mean error,” with a much larger kernel: 
Error propagation requires paper or color and reduces the number of quantization levels. The main application of error diffusion is to reduce the number of quantization states, which can only be two per channel. This makes the image suitable for creating twofiles on printers such as black and white laser printers.
In the following discussion, it is assumed that a fraction of the number of quantization states in the total scattered image error is two channels, unless otherwise indicated.
Univariate Alarm Propagation
In its simplest form, a scan is often one line at a time and one pixel at a time.The current pixels are compared to reduce them to half the gray value. If it is usually greater than the value, a rendered pixel is generated in the linked image.If the pixel is less than 50% of the path luminance, a black pixel may be created. When the target is a palette but not monochrome, various methods can be used, such as defining a threshold with value pairs when the target is a black, gray, and white color palette.the pixel has always been either completely bright or black altogether, so there is only one flaw in the image.Then it is considered that the error is added to the next pixel in the image, and the average value is repeatedis.
2D Error Propagation
1D error propagation is prone to severe image artifacts that appear as separate ascending and descending lines.2D error propagation reduces visual stimulus artifacts.The simplest algorithm is too good one-dimensional error propagation, except that part of the error is added to this next pixel, and half of the error is usually added to the pixel on the next line below.
Further refinement can easily be achieved by further removing the actual defect in the existing pixel, as shown in the aforementioned matrices in the digital age. The musical image at the beginning of the article is an example of error propagation from the second point of view.
Color Error Propagation
Silent mode algorithms can be applied to each of red, green, blue, and (or cyan, magenta, yellow, black) color TV channels for a color effect on printers. ci as color laser printers that are likely to only print individual color values.
However, improved visual results can be achieved by first converting the color channels of interest into a distinguishable color pattern that safely separates the luma, hue and saturation grooves so that more weight. high due to diffusion errors is applied to the luminance channel. only to that tint channel. The motivation for this transformation, in turn, is that the human eye perceives small differences in brightness in small local areas better than differences in hue on the same edge, and even more than differences in saturation in a real area.
For example, if there is a young error in the green channel, it cannot be displayed, and another compact error in the red channel in the same case, a well balanced sum of the two can be used to correct an obvious defect i Luminance, which can be listed in a balanced way between the three color channels (depending on its respective statistical contribution to you, brightness), even if this results in a much larger error for the hue when the green channel is turned on. This error can propagate to edge pixels.
Also, any of these sources of perception may require gamma correction if it is not on a linear scale, human vision suffers, so why is there error diffusion that returns to these corrected linear channels? the gamma before the final color channels of the round can linearly produce a pixel color, flipped to convert to a corrected non-gamma image format, and from which our new residual error is computed and converted to again for display in the next pixels.
Distribution Of Errors Over Several Gray Levels
Error Can also be used to distribute output posters of more than two quality types (per channel for color images). This applies exactlyMatrix printers that can create multiple, 8 or 16 planes in virtually any image plane, such as electrostatic printers and displays in compact cell phones. Rather than using just one to generate the threshold binary output, an acceptable neighborhood level is determined and human error, if any, propagates for the reason described above.
Most printers tend to slightly overlap black dots, so there is currently no exact relationship between dot frequency (in dots per GPS controlled area) and brightness. Along the track, you can apply linear gradation from tone to scale so that the printed image is correct.
Advantage Over Easy Maintenance
When the image changes from light to dark, the error propagation algorithm tends tomake the next generated pixel black. The transition from dark to light is usually triggered the next time.creates a refined ixel. This results in the end result of improved edges due to the levelPoor reading accuracy. This results in unwanted scattering with a higher apparent resolution than other shielding methods. This is especially important for images that contain text, such as a regular fax message.
This effect is clearly visible in your image above in this case article. The grass details and most of the text on the panel are accurately preserved,and lightness in this sky with little details. Cluster-Dot a good grayscale image of the same image would be much less sharp.
- Floyd-Steinberg tremor.
- Bug Propagation in Matlab
- ^ Richard Howland Ranger, system fax. U.S. Patent 1,790,723, issued February 3, 1931.
- ^ JF Jarvis, KN Judis, and W.H. Ninke, Analysis of continuous tone display methods on two-stage projection screens. Image and Computer Graphics Processing, 5: 1: 13-40 (1976).
Wiki Sulla Diffusione Degli Errori
오류 확산 위키
Fout Diffusie Wiki
Viki Po Rasprostraneniyu Oshibok
Wiki O Dyfuzji Bledow
Wiki De Diffusion D Erreurs
Wiki De Difusion De Errores
Wiki De Difusao De Erro